Title :
Fabrications and Characterizations of NbN/AlN/NbN Junctions for THz Applications
Author :
Liu, X. ; Kang, L. ; Sun, J. ; Chang, L. ; Zhao, S.Q. ; Ji, Z.M. ; Wu, P.H.
Author_Institution :
Nanjing Univ., Nanjing
Abstract :
We present our process for fabricating NbN/AlN/NbN tunnel junctions on MgO substrates. The current-voltage (I-V) characteristics of junctions were measured, and together with the other characteristics in high frequency, especially in the terahertz band.
